3,3-Difluoropyrrolidine hydrochloride
3,3-Difluoropyrrolidine hydrochloride (CAS: 163457-23-6) is a fluorinated heterocyclic building block with the molecular formula C4H7F2N · HCl and a molecular weight of 143.56 g/mol. This compound serves as a valuable intermediate in organic synthesis, particularly for the introduction of the difluoropyrrolidine moiety into more complex molecular structures. Its applications are primarily found within the fine chemical and pharmaceutical research sectors for novel compound development.

| Molecular weight | 143.56 |
|---|---|
| Empirical formula | C4H7F2N · HCl |
| Assay | 97% |
| Melting point | 133-136 °C |

Hazard statements
- H315Causes skin irritation
- H319Causes serious eye irritation
- H335May cause respiratory irritation
